Google Photos adds ‘Quick Edits’ when you share images

68% Informative
Google Photos adds 'Quick Edits' feature that lets you edit an image as you share it without necessarily saving those changes to your library.
The changes will be saved when sharing in Google Photos itself, creating a shared link, or adding the image to a shared Google Photos album.
The feature only works for images that you haven’t already edited.
